The school's main campus is located in a small town (in Lexington, VA). The maximum program length is more than 4 years. The highest degree offered by the school is the Bachelor's degree.

In Fall 2002, the school had 1,299 (full-time equivalent) students. In Fall 2002, 381 male students and 26 female students enrolled as first-time students (freshmen, typically). Male students comprised 93.6% of the student body, while females made up 6.4%.
Minority enrollment included African-American (6)%, Hispanic (3)%, Asian (3)%, and Native American (1)%.

Virginia Military Institute is accredited regionally by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ools, Commission on Colleges (SACSCC). The school is state accredited.
